Cost of Living in Opelousas, LA - Updated Prices & Insights

Monthly Cost of Living

Living costs for one person come to about $2,560 monthly including rent, or $1,026 excluding housing.

Estimated monthly costs for a couple: $3,761 with rent, or $1,960 without housing.

Monthly costs for a family of three come to about $4,961 including rent, or $2,893 for daily expenses alone.

Cost Breakdown

Expect to pay about $1,606 for a central one-bedroom, or $1,360 outside the center. At 53% of the average salary ($3,018), housing is the biggest financial pressure.

Average take-home pay sits at $3,018, while typical expenses reach $2,560. This leaves some room for savings, though a comfortable buffer starts closer to $3,840.

Expect to spend about $390 monthly on groceries. Dining out at a mid-range restaurant costs roughly $75.0 for two.

What are typical monthly expenses for a single person in Opelousas, LA?
All in, Opelousas, LA runs about $2,560 monthly with rent, or $1,026 without it. These numbers assume a moderate lifestyle – comfortable but not lavish. Choosing a cheaper neighborhood and cooking at home are the easiest ways to spend less.
What are the monthly living expenses in Opelousas, LA as of 2026?
As of 2026, monthly living costs in Opelousas, LA come to around $2,560 including rent, or roughly $1,026 excluding it. Numbers shift a bit by season and neighborhood, but this range works well as a planning baseline.
How does the average salary in Opelousas, LA compare to the cost of living?
At $3,018 take-home, most residents in Opelousas, LA can cover the $2,560 monthly cost of living. Those earning $3,840 or more have room to save; below-average earners will find things noticeably tighter.
What does a one-bedroom apartment cost in Opelousas, LA per month?
Where you live in Opelousas, LA makes all the difference. Central one-bedrooms cost about $1,606; commute-friendly outer districts come in around $1,360. Overall, the market runs from $1,360 to $1,606 depending on size, location, and apartment condition.
